As a result of the war we are going through, and because our enemy is extensively using the Iranian “Shahed” drone technology, we have developed our own system.
And today, we are sharing what we have developed with countries in the Middle East. Ukraine is highly regarded for this. We have shifted the geopolitical landscape.
Everyone understands that Russia is sharing intelligence with Iran. And everyone understands that, in terms of expertise, no one today can help the way Ukraine can.
We are discussing several areas to ensure mutually beneficial cooperation. The first area is weapons, production, exchange of experience, and the exchange of resources that may not be available in one country or another. The second track concerns long-term energy cooperation.
We're talking about ten-year partnerships. We have already signed a relevant agreement with Saudi Arabia, and we have also signed a ten-year agreement with Qatar.
Over these ten years, we will focus on co-production, building manufacturing facilities—production lines in Ukraine and in these countries. We will also address, for example, how to supply a country with diesel in the event of shortages and major global challenges. Yesterday, I reached an agreement on diesel supplies for at least one year. From there, it becomes a matter for our companies and the local companies.

When I travel outside of Ukraine, I get daily intelligence updates online. This morning, I was briefed that U.S. military facilities in the Middle East and the Gulf region were photographed by Russian satellites in the interests of Iran.
On March 24th, they imaged the U.S.–UK joint military facility on Diego Garcia located in the Chagos Archipelago in the Indian Ocean. They also captured pictures of Kuwait International Airport and parts of the infrastructure of the Greater Burgan oil field. On March 25th, they took pictures of the Prince Sultan Air Base in Saudi Arabia. The Shaybah oil and gas field in Saudi Arabia, İncirlik Air Base in Türkiye, and Al Udeid Air Base in Qatar were all imaged on March 26th.
There are no Ukrainian facilities on this list. But who is helping whom when sanctions are lifted from an aggressor that earns daily revenue and provides intelligence for strikes against American, Middle Eastern, UK, and U.S.–UK bases and so on?
When surveillance is carried out over facilities in Ukraine, we always understand that they must be protected, since plans are in motion to destroy them – energy and water infrastructure, military facilities, and so on. Everyone knows that repeated reconnaissance indicates preparations for strikes. How can sanctions be eased if this is what the Russians are doing?
There must be pressure on the aggressor. And lifting sanctions is certainly not pressure. It looks strange. Sanctions are being lifted, while the aggressor is providing intelligence to strike facilities, including those of the countries that are discussing or have already lifted sanctions.
